Evil and Stupid

One of the makers of the 1010.org video is Franny Armstrong, whose documentary “The Age of Stupid” blamed a great deal of the global warming “problem” on aviation. The film premiered in New York City last year, where “Not Evil Just Wrong’s” Phelim McAleer attended and asked attendees how they reached the Big Apple from their faraway locations. Lots of discomfort and shuffling from Franny and actress Gillian Armstrong (who appeared in the 1010.org video) — but at least they didn’t blow up.
